Property Oracle says ..
The property is located in Harbertonford, Totnes, Devon, which is a desirable area in the South Hams district of South West England. The area benefits from being close to the town of Totnes, providing access to amenities and transport links. The proximity to Harbertonford Church of England Primary School (0.60 KM) is a positive for families. While other schools are further away (4.46 KM - 4.93 KM), Totnes offers a wider range of educational options. The presence of a railway station (Totnes, 4.98 KM) adds to the convenience of the location. The property itself is an end of terrace house with a garden, suggesting a good amount of outdoor space, especially considering the plot size of 740.56 sqft.
Based on the images, the property appears to be in good condition. The interior looks well-maintained and modern, with updated fixtures and fittings. There is no visible evidence of significant repairs or renovations needed. The kitchen and bathroom seem recently updated. The property benefits from a good size garden.
The list price of £350,000 is slightly above the average price for the area (£275,043), however, this is understandable given that the average property size in the area is 1320 sqft, whereas this property is smaller at 630.44 sqft. The average price per sqft in the area is £208.00, and while the provided data doesn’t allow for a precise calculation of the price per sqft for this property, a rough estimate suggests it’s reasonably priced for the area, considering the condition and the inclusion of a garden. The nearby listings show a range of prices, with some significantly higher, suggesting that the £350,000 price is within the market range for similar properties in Harbertonford.
Therefore, we give this property 7 / 10. *Disclaimer: This is our option and does constitute a recommendation or financial advice. Do your own research. *
